About Hayong Jung

Hayong Jung is a scholar working on Radiology, Nuclear Medicine and Imaging, Biomedical Engineering and Mechanics of Materials, having authored 25 papers that have together received 411 indexed citations. Recurring topics across this work include Ultrasound Imaging and Elastography (12 papers), Microfluidic and Bio-sensing Technologies (9 papers) and Ultrasonics and Acoustic Wave Propagation (7 papers). The work is most often cited by research in Biomedical Engineering (305 citations), Radiology, Nuclear Medicine and Imaging (125 citations) and Biophysics (25 citations). Hayong Jung has collaborated with scholars based in United States, South Korea and Hong Kong. Frequent co-authors include K. Kirk Shung, Changyang Lee, Hae Gyun Lim, Chi Woo Yoon, Hojong Choi, Qifa Zhou, Ruimin Chen, Hyung Ham Kim, Nan Sook Lee and K. Kirk Shung. Their work appears in journals such as SHILAP Revista de lepidopterología, Scientific Reports and Sensors.
